> I can confirm it builds and works fine on `x86_64-musl`.

Did you run make check? Because there are some test failures that only seem to happen for x86_64-musl, e.g.:

```
0>> integrate(atan(sqrt(1-x**2)),x,0,1)
"Unable to handle singularities of -1/2*pi-sqrt(2)*(-1/2*pi-atan(sqrt(2)*x*((-1/2*(-2*sqrt(-x^2+1)+2)/x)^2-1)/(-2*sqrt(-x^2+1)+2)))-atan(x*((-1/2*(-2*sqrt(-x^2+1)+2)/x)^2-1)/(-2*sqrt(-x^2+1)+2))+x*atan(sqrt(-x^2+1)) at [undef] Error: Bad Argument Value"
```

I don't use musl myself.
